Chen Fenghe paused for a moment, then continued walking forward a few steps without looking back.

But in the end, she sighed, turned around and walked back to the man.

The man who had just spoken coldly had now fallen to the ground, unconscious.

Shen Fenghe grabbed his wrist to feel his pulse, and the moment she touched his skin, she was startled by the heat from his body.

You can feel it without a thermometer, your body temperature is at least 39 degrees!

If he ignored it, in ancient times, on a cold night, he might not even know how he died!

Chen Fenghe immediately took his pulse, but his pulse was neither the floating and slow pulse of wind-cold fever nor the floating and rapid pulse of wind-heat fever, but rather a strong pulse.

In other words, his fever symptoms were not caused by the invasion of cold or heat toxins, but by wound infection.

Chen Fenghe frowned slightly and observed the man's movements quietly.

I saw his left hand subconsciously pressing on his left abdomen.

She didn't care about anything else and raised her hand to undress his upper body to check. When she saw it, Shen Fenghe couldn't help but gasp!

I saw that on the left side of his abdomen, where his eight-pack abs were, there was a wound left by an arrow, which was already festering and oozing pus!

With such a serious wound infection, he didn't go see a doctor immediately, but went hunting and even gave the prey away. Is he a fool?

What's going on in this man's head?

Chen Fenghe subconsciously looked at the black cloth on his face.

How could he ignore his own injuries and go hunting to send prey to her? Could it be that he has some connection with me or the original owner?

Although half of his face was covered, upon closer inspection, she felt as if the man's eyebrows and eyes looked familiar!

She hesitated for a moment, then reached out her hand towards the black cloth on his face...

Just as her hand was about to touch the black cloth, a large hand suddenly grabbed her wrist, and then a low, cold voice said, "Young lady, please... respect yourself. I... am ugly, and I don't want others to see me..."

Chen Fenghe: “…”

Could the lies be any less sincere?

However, she was caught in the act, so she couldn't force it. She withdrew her hand and said deliberately, "I already said I'm a man dressed as a woman. Don't call me a little girl. Just call me brother."

Isn't it just wearing a vest? Who can't do that?

The man obviously didn't expect that she could lie with her eyes open. An incomprehensible bitter smile appeared on the corner of his mouth, which seemed to be both helpless and bitter.

Chen Fenghe said sternly, "Your wound has become festered. I'm going to use a dagger to cut off the rotten flesh and rebandage it. Otherwise, I'm afraid you'll die soon."

The man also knew the condition of his wound. He had planned to finish the last thing today and then stop following her. He wanted to go to the town to see a doctor early the next morning. Unexpectedly, he developed a high fever in the evening. The severity of the fever was beyond his expectations!

His face was pale, with beads of sweat on his forehead. He nodded gently and said, "Thank you, little lady... Thank you, brother... I can endure the pain, brother, there is no need to show mercy..."

The one who chased him out and saved him tonight wasn't her, but a brother—this was the fact he had to remember...

Chen Fenghe glanced at him indifferently, then took out the anesthetic needle from the space and injected it into the skin near his wound.

She has anesthetics, why should she endure the pain?

The sting of the needle was so intense that it was almost impossible to even feel it over the pain of the festering wound.

Soon, the anesthetic took effect, his eyes began to blur, and then he quickly fell into a deep sleep.

Chen Fenghe rolled up his wide sleeves, took out saline solution and hydrogen peroxide from the space, cleaned the abscess wound several times, and after cleaning out the exudate, he took out a scalpel and carefully removed the necrotic tissue. Then, he disinfected the wound with iodine, applied tissue-growing ointment, wrapped it with gauze, and then wrapped it with linen, which was common in this dynasty, to complete the bandage.

She then gave him a shot of antibiotics to help reduce his fever.

Then she took out a cloak made of sheepskin from the space and covered him with it.

The anesthetic lasted for about an hour, or about half an hour. Therefore, even after all this tossing and turning, the man didn't wake up, but instead slept quietly with his head tilted.

Chen Fenghe hugged her shoulders, staring at the black cloth on his face. Then, without much mental preparation, she raised her hand and pulled the black cloth off.

She didn't intend to be a gentleman, so there was no reason for her to not watch it just because he didn't let her.

He won't die if you look at him.

The black cloth was removed, and Chen Fenghe looked at the familiar handsome face under the black cloth and couldn't help but sigh in her heart.

really.

Who else could this man be if not Jiang Shuo?

But, the last time we met in Daming Prefecture, wasn't he fleeing famine with a man and a woman? How did he become single?

Moreover, the wound is so seriously infected?

Thinking of this, Shen Fenghe couldn't help but feel a little guilty.

If she had not given him the medicine out of anger when she was in Daming Prefecture that day, his wound would not have become so infected.

If she hadn't happened to chase him out tonight, he might have really died in this wilderness from the infection of the wound!

Thinking about the pheasants and sables he sent me these past two days, could it be that it was because of that time in the mountains that he was still thinking about being "responsible" or something?

But if he wanted to be "responsible", why did he act so coldly and pretend not to know her, and even chased her away?

Chen Fenghe sighed. The thoughts of the ancients were quite difficult to guess...

No matter what, she saved his life today, and they can be even from now on.

Chen Fenghe thought about it, looked around, and then took great pains to drag the still sleeping Jiang Shuo to a sheltered place behind some rocks.

She took some spiritual spring water from the space, carefully fed it to him, and filled the cowhide water bag he was carrying with the spiritual spring water.

These spiritual spring waters should be able to help his injuries heal faster.

She also prescribed several prescriptions, including common Chinese medicines for treating wound infections and suppuration, such as Angelica dahurica, Houttuynia cordata, and Houttuynia cordata. She wrapped them in straw paper and then wrapped them in a piece of cloth.

She also put the bottle of golden wound medicine that she bought in Daming Prefecture last time into his bag, and also stuffed some wild boar meat jerky, big meat buns, and a few taels of silver in it.

After doing all this, Chen Fenghe wrapped the black cloth around his face again.

After staying there for almost another hour, the effect of the anesthetic was almost wearing off.

After Chen Fenghe was sure that the fever on his body had subsided and his life was no longer in danger, he quietly left through the space.

He pretended not to know her before and refused to show his true face. I guess... he didn't want to be recognized by her, right?

She stayed here waiting for him to wake up, which made things awkward for both of them.

Moreover, she is now an exile after all, and the assassins sent by the Fifth Prince and her scumbag father are eyeing her life. If she drags him into this, she will only implicate him.

It would be better for us to say goodbye now and forget each other.
